2011-05-08 12 views
27

Estoy usando Visual Studio 2010 Ultimate edition, pero ahora no mostrará la página de propiedades del proyecto. En su lugar aparece un mensaje de error que dice Ha ocurrido un error al intentar cargar la página. El objeto COM que se ha separado de su RCW subyacente no se puede usar.Página de propiedades de VS 2010 Error al mostrar: el objeto COM que se ha separado de su RCW subyacente no se puede usar

Este error me ha plagado durante mucho tiempo. Intenté casi todo (uninstall/reinstall/repair/uninstall addins, etc.) excepto reinstalar el sistema operativo . Ayúdame. ¡Muchas gracias!

+0

todavía se presenta el problema si se inicia el IDE de Visual Studio en [safe mode] (http://msdn.microsoft.com/en-us/library/ms241278.aspx)? –

Respuesta

33

Finalmente descubrí qué había salido mal. Se está comportando mal addin - TestDriven.NET. Pero las cosas podrían ser diferentes para ti. Pero de todos modos, es complementos. El proceso para encontrar esto es que ve al cuadro de diálogo "Herramientas -> Opciones". Vaya al nodo "Entorno -> Complementos/Macros Security". Desmarque "Permitir que se carguen los componentes adicionales". Y luego reinicie VS 2010 para ver si el problema desaparece. Si lo hace, entonces debe ser un complemento en las carpetas especificadas. Y el próximo paso es habilitar complementos para cargar y eliminar los directorios en la lista uno por uno para identificar qué complemento causó el problema. Y, por último, deshabilítelo o simplemente elimínelo/desinstálelo.

+6

Si respondió su propia pregunta, marque su respuesta como aceptada. –

+0

¡Gracias! Esto resolvió el mismo problema para mí. Eliminé varias carpetas según tu respuesta. –

+0

Si Visual Studio es tonto y no le permite eliminar las carpetas de complementos, puede eliminarlas manualmente desde aquí: HKEY_LOCAL_MACHINE \ SOFTWARE \ Wow6432Node \ Microsoft \ VisualStudio \ 10.0 \ AutomationOptions \ LookInFolders –

1

en mi caso fue la última actualización de VSCommands para VS2010 ... una desinstalación completa/volver a instalar de los VSCommands hizo el trabajo :)

0

También se dio cuenta de que era TestDriven.Net que estaba creando el problema. Mi problema es cómo uso TestDriven.Net en dicho escenario. ¿Hay alguna solución para poder evitar el error y seguir usando TestDriven.Net

8

Reiniciado VS 2010 SP1 resolvió mi problema !!!

+1

También funcionó para mí. No tengo TestDriven.Net instalado. – Noich

1

Esto también me pasó por algún motivo desconocido y resultó que tuve que deshabilitar el plugin de control de fuente (el predeterminado que había estado felizmente trabajando durante mucho tiempo): Tools -> Options -> Source control : set plug-in to "None" y reiniciar VS.

+0

Tuve que hacer esto y mi problema se solucionó. Pude volver a encenderlo y el problema no ha regresado. ¡Gracias! – liebs19

1

Estaba enfrentando el mismo problema en Microsoft Visual Studio Professional 2015 Service Pack 1. Descubrí que estaba sucediendo debido a Comunidad GhostDoc.

He actualizado GhostDoc 4.9.x 5.1.x Comunidad y emisión resolverá en Studio 2015 Service Pack 1. Visual

+1

gracias, estaba perdiendo la esperanza de que todas estas referencias a vs2010 - y tu viniste como un rayo de sol - fuera también para mí, vs2015.3 – user230910

+0

Estoy contento de escuchar que mi respuesta es útil para ti. –

Cuestiones relacionadas